Beech Island is contained in a comprehensive list of Post Offices that was created by Cameron Blevins and Richard Helbock.<1>

From that list:

The Beech Island post office opened in 1873 and had closed by 1904.

Business Atlas and Shippers' Guide (1895)
Published by Rand McNally & Co.

A note taken from the Shipper's Guide for Beech Island:
Services available in 1895: had a Post Office, a Railroad Station, a Express Office
